Volker Türk is a scholar working on Political Science and International Relations, Sociology and Political Science and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Volker Türk has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 118 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Political Science and International Relations, 9 papers in Sociology and Political Science and 1 paper in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Volker Türk’s work include Migration, Refugees, and Integration (7 papers), Global Peace and Security Dynamics (7 papers) and Asian Geopolitics and Ethnography (6 papers). Volker Türk is often cited by papers focused on Migration, Refugees, and Integration (7 papers), Global Peace and Security Dynamics (7 papers) and Asian Geopolitics and Ethnography (6 papers). Volker Türk collaborates with scholars based in Switzerland, United States and Belgium. Volker Türk's co-authors include Erik Eyster, A. David Edwards, Tedros Adhanom Ghebreyesus, Catherine Russell, T. Alexander Aleinikoff, Débora Diniz, Rajat Khosla, Laura Laski, Gita Sen and Alice Edwards and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, The Lancet and Journal of Cleaner Production.
